Wedderburn is a small town located in the Loddon Shire of Victoria, Australia. It is situated approximately 160 kilometres northwest of Melbourne, 50minutes from Bendigo and is known for its rich gold mining history. Wedderburn was first settled in the 1850s and quickly became an important hub for gold mining in the area. The town's population boomed during the gold rush, and many of the historic buildings that can be found there today were built during this time. Today, Wedderburn is a quiet and picturesque town with a population of just over 1,000 people. It is a popular destination for tourists who are interested in the area's history and the surrounding natural beauty. The town is surrounded by rolling hills and bushland, and the nearby Loddon River provides opportunities for fishing, swimming, and other recreational activities.
